Output d4b96d61f57d7477fca34fb0c6f03e6df116782fe02234fc185af4aa9a767b92:27

value
943000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8888c049633e973c2ebd5b03af33cab450f3e0b OP_EQUAL
address
3MRwTRjKEMBd8H7yehR2AaU9pYrKmWAwKQ
transaction
d4b96d61f57d7477fca34fb0c6f03e6df116782fe02234fc185af4aa9a767b92
confirmations
229538
spent
true